Zusammenfassung: | REGENERATIVE-CYCLE INCANDESCENT LAMP CONTAINING HgBr2 ADDITIVE The useful life of high-efficiency type brominetungsten cycle incandescent lamps, such as those used in TVstudio and theater lighting applications, is enhanced by dosing the lamps with a carefully controlled quantity of mercuric bromide (HgBr2) which dissociates when the filament of the finished lamp is energized and provides a predetermined amount of Br2 within the envelope during lamp operation. The quantity of HgBr2 dosed into the envelope is adjusted according to the design life and initial efficiency parameters of the specific lamp type so as to provide a concentration of Br2 within the envelope which is correlated with such parameters and prevents blackening of the envelope and premature failure of the filament at the particular "lifeefficiency level" of operation for which the lamp is designed. For a 1000 watt 120 volt tubular incandescent lamp (DXW type) having a design life of 150 hours and an efficiency of 28 LPW, the HgBr2 dosage is such that it provides from about 2.5 to 6 torr of Br2 within the lamp during operation ---whereas a lamp of the same wattage and voltage rating designed to operate for 50 hours at 33 LPW (DXN type) is dosed with a slightly larger quantity of HgBr2 to provide from about 3.5 to 8.5 torr of Br2 within the operating lamp. |
